Fast onboarding and lightweight sharing for teams
TorchPhoto also makes it much easier to bring other people into the workflow.
With the latest update, you can generate and share a TorchPhoto QR code so the recipient can quickly add the same FTP server inside the TorchPhoto app. This is especially useful when onboarding employees, teammates, or clients who need fast access without entering server details manually.
If the recipient cannot install TorchPhoto, there is still a simple alternative. You can quickly send a compressed file containing the thumbnail images you already generated. Because these are lightweight low- to medium-quality image samples, the recipient can review the visual contents much faster than waiting for full-resolution originals.
This makes TorchPhoto useful not only as a personal browsing tool, but also as a practical way to speed up server access, preview sharing, and communication across different devices and users.
